Funding of the Projects of the St. Vincenz-Hospital Limburg Foundation
The St. Vincenz-Hospital Limburg Foundation continuously supports projects of the St. Vincenz Limburg Hospital Society that go beyond the purely medical mission – such as services for tumor patients, palliative care, pastoral care, art and music projects, as well as special offerings for employees and children.

Grant criteria
Funding objective
The aim of the funding is to strengthen regional healthcare provision in the Limburg-Weilburg area and to provide added value to the patients and staff of St. Vincenz Hospital Limburg through additional projects and services. Initiatives in areas such as tumor therapy, palliative care, pastoral care, art and music in the hospital, projects for sick children and adolescents, as well as support services for staff will be funded.
Eligible to apply
- Public Institutions
- Non-profit Organizations

Description
The funding provided by the St. Vincenz-Hospital Limburg Foundation is aimed at public institutions and non-profit organizations in Hesse that wish to implement projects beyond the core medical services. Grants support initiatives covering a range from tumor therapy support to palliative care and pastoral services, as well as art and music offerings within the hospital. Furthermore, the foundation promotes special measures for sick children and adolescents, heart pillow and hospital clown projects, as well as programs to enhance the well-being of staff. The decision-making process is based on strict content criteria and a democratic consensus-building process that ensures the quality and sustainability of each project. The continuous allocation of funds enables reliable planning and long-term impact in the everyday care environment of St. Vincenz-Hospital Limburg.
Funding is provided for patients of all ages – especially tumor patients and those receiving palliative care – children and adolescents, as well as hospital staff and visitors. The goal is to strengthen regional healthcare provision in the Limburg-Weilburg area and to make inpatient stays more humane and effective through additional services. Applications can be submitted year-round, allowing sponsors of health, cultural, and social projects to take advantage of flexible application deadlines.
